Along with Bill Medley, Hatfield turned out 5 top-five hits in the 1960s, including "You've Lost that Lovin' Feeling," which is reported to be one of the two most played songs in the history of radio ("Yesterday" is the other). He and Hatfield opened for The Beatles on their first U.S. Tour in 1964. The single had "Unchained Melody," with no producer credit on the label, as the flip to Gerry Goffin and Carole King's "Hung on You," but many DJs preferred "Unchained Melody" and played that one instead. In 1964, music producer Phil Spector conducted the band at a show in San Francisco where the Righteous Brothers was also appearing, and he was impressed enough with the duo to want them to record for his own label, Philles Records. Four versions of the song made the Top 40 in 1955, three of them simultaneously in the Top 20: Les Baxter (#1 - from the movie, In 1995, Robson And Jerome released this as a single with "The White Cliffs Of Dover."
